Frogs of Western Australia describes a selection of frogs that either live in the metropolitan area, are likely to be seen elsewhere, or are of special interest due to their habits or rarity.

Australia is blessed with a remarkable number and variety of frogs. More than a third of Australia's total frog fauna occurs in Western Australia, and more than half of these are found only in Western Australia. The State's 80 or so frog species have a remarkable variety of shapes, sizes, life histories and mating calls.
